Sugarloaf Vacation Rental ~ 7 Mi to Big Bear Lake!
Get away from it all and step into adventure at this inviting Sugarloaf vacation rental! This Star Wars-themed, 3-bedroom, 1.5-bath cabin named ‘Yoda Maple Cabin’ offers a comfortable and cozy atmosphere. After hitting the slopes at Snow Summit, checking out nearby hiking trails, or having fun on the water at Big Bear Lake, return to unwind by the fireplace. Grill up a meal on the deck while taking in tree-lined views. In any season, this retreat is the perfect getaway for outdoor enthusiasts!

We enjoyed our stay at this cute Yoda, Star Wars themed cabin. So thoughtfully decorated and equipped. Lots of great little touches. Nice kitchen and appliances, comfortable furniture and beds, large deck with BBQ and dining table. Huge, level yard with plenty of parking and room for corn hole and other games. Also, lots of mature pine trees for shade. Located on Maple Lane which is the main street through Sugar Loaf, so there is some road noise, but the house is set back from the roadway making it feel very private. Would stay here again!

Okay 2-night Winter Stay
Overall it was a nice stay, but it was very much overpriced for what the cabin offers considering its size and location on the outskirts of Big Bear (12/15 mins drive to the Village). The living room, kitchen and downstairs bathroom are all small and not adequate for a group of three or more if you want to cook together or relax as a group in the living room. The main heater worked great and the fire place was nice to have. The upstairs room heater is a nice touch. It is a quiet area. Communication with Evolve was great. Ashley was very responsive and very helpful throughout my stay. However, many small details appear to have been completely overlooked during the last clean-up / prep of the house before my stay: the trashcans outside were full and overflowing upon my arrival, no sponge to be found in the kitchen, no body wash in the shower dispenser, no hand soap in the upstairs bathroom, empty jars labeled “coffee” and “tea”, and more... Unfortunately, all this combined with a lengthy to-do list required for check-out adds up to not justifying the cost I paid for this stay.
